02.05.2022
The HCJ rejected HaMoked’s petition to dismantle the Qaffin segment of the Separation Barrier in the West Bank
07.03.2022
The HCJ grants HaMoked’s petition: Military must amend the harsh “tiny plot” restriction used to prevent West Bank farmers from accessing their lands inside the Seam Zone
08.02.2022
Ahead of the court hearing on HaMoked’s petition to dismantle the Qaffin segment of the Separation Barrier inside the West Bank
07.11.2021
Bureaucratic ordeal to operate a business behind the Separation Barrier: Only following HaMoked’s petition, the military issued a commerce permit to enter the Seam Zone
01.11.2021
For months, the military failed to open the Far’un agricultural gate on schedule, preventing farmers from reaching their lands trapped beyond the Separation Barrier; some improvement following HaMoked’s petition
25.10.2021
“Creeping Dispossession”: HaMoked’s new report on the steady escalation in restrictions Israel imposes on Palestinian farming beyond the Separation Barrier
13.07.2021
High Court of Justice rejected HaMoked’s petition: the military can demand that inheritors of plots trapped in the Seam Zone formally register as owners as a condition for getting a permit to cultivate their lands. The petition prompted the state to reduce the land registration fee from 1% of the land’s value to a fixed fee of 160 NIS
06.06.2021
In response to HaMoked petition to the High Court of Justice (HCJ): the state agrees in principle that older Palestinians do not need a special permit to enter the “Seam Zone” – however the implementation is impractical
14.04.2021
HaMoked to the High Court of Justice: Israel must open the “Magen Dan” gate year-round as promised or dismantle the separation barrier in the area of a-Zawiya, where the gate is located
16.03.2021
Only following HaMoked’s petition: the military issued permits of “permanent residence in the Seam Zone” to two brothers who live in the Barta’a area, entirely fenced off by the Separation Barrier
